Ryan Roberts, 33, a fisherman of Block B Bath Settlement, West Coast Berbice, is feared dead following a fishing boat mishap off the Atlantic coast on Wednesday night.
The man reportedly fell overboard after a heavy wave struck the vessel while the crew was hauling in a seine net. He was pulled back aboard but is said to have sustained a broken leg.
According to information gathered, as the crew attempted to return to shore, the rough seas worsened. The boat began taking in water and capsized about five minutes into the return journey. Survivors placed the injured Roberts on an icebox to help him stay afloat as they swam toward land.
Another powerful wave then struck, separating the men in the water. When the seas calmed, the icebox had broken apart and Roberts was nowhere to be found.
The remaining crew members were rescued by another fishing vessel hours later. Roberts remains missing and is feared drowned.
Search efforts are expected to continue.
